Outside of the US, users around the world have been attempting to download Pokemon GO using an app, circumventing the official app store. Since the app's release, traffic to apkmirror.com exploded, increasing from just over 600,000 visits on July 5th to over 4 million visits on July 6th.
In total, 30.5% of all desktop search traffic over this period came from searches with the term "Pokemon" in them.
